Output dc73f4e55bccf455409a22ea92d5786a1a0a683e55e3eb2073fcc8872a64f6b4:31

value
103320955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d6d5e5d92d8cf6c51e71f517aba07fafcc6efde OP_EQUAL
address
3Jxces5p6xXTzGJKRHu3WnNjkMfxFkrae4
transaction
dc73f4e55bccf455409a22ea92d5786a1a0a683e55e3eb2073fcc8872a64f6b4
spent
true